萨帕哈纳美景

2020-09-08 03:29发布

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


  1. 亲爱的专家们,我知道哪个联接将带来哪个表(内部联接,引用联接,左外部联接,右外部联接)中的数据,我们最近创建了带有开票凭证维类型的计算视图... 从销售单据表,开票表,客户主表等中获取所需数据。在这里,我的疑问是如何确定有关表的联接。我们如何确定有关联接或表名的基数?

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


  1. 亲爱的专家们,我知道哪个联接将带来哪个表(内部联接,引用联接,左外部联接,右外部联接)中的数据,我们最近创建了带有开票凭证维类型的计算视图... 从销售单据表,开票表,客户主表等中获取所需数据。在这里,我的疑问是如何确定有关表的联接。我们如何确定有关联接或表名的基数?
付费偷看设置
发送
2条回答
三十六小时_GS
1楼-- · 2020-09-08 03:37

Vijay,你好

请具体说明您的要求。 连接和基数取决于情况。 您列出了很多表,但未包括预期的结果。

内部联接:当它们与两个表之间的记录匹配时适用

左外部联接:适用于两个表之间的至少一个匹配并且考虑了左表的所有值。

右外部联接:当两个表与右表的所有值之间至少一个匹配时适用。

引用联接:当从右表查询其列时,充当内部联接;否则,如果保持引用完整性,将充当左外部联接。

还有许多其他的连接,可以使用临时连接,动态连接等。

联接和基数设置会因情况而异。

1:1-主要用于内部联接。

1:n-多用于右外连接

N:1-多用于左外连接。

希望这会有所帮助!

谢谢

Subramaniyan Ganesan

何必丶何苦呢
2楼-- · 2020-09-08 03:54

嗨@subramaniyan Ganesan ...感谢您的出色回复...

我需要进一步澄清...就您的专业知识而言,您可能会觉得一个愚蠢的问题...

也就是说,假设我们创建表A和表B的右外部连接...,因为我们所有人都知道表A和表B之间至少有一个匹配项...。​​它从表" A中获取所有字段 " 对...? 现在我怀疑是假设在表A和表B中的"地址"字段,然后最终从哪个表中提取A或B的地址数据...?

如果A和B中的"地址"字段具有相同的数据,那么为什么我们要加入A和B ...并且如果两个表中的"地址"字段相同,那么我们将观察到什么变化。

对不起,如果我的问题使您感到困惑。

谢谢...

一周热门 更多>